This role sits within the Finance team and is responsible for key components of the month-end close, maintaining balance sheet integrity, and supporting the accuracy and completeness of financial reporting. The position reports to the Controller and manages a Senior Accountant, with ownership over designated accounting areas and contributions to the continued development and scalability of the function.

Job Description

* Manage assigned areas of the month-end close, including preparation, review, and reconciliation of key balance sheet accounts
* Ensure accuracy and completeness of financial data, identifying and resolving discrepancies as needed
* Oversee and review the work of a Senior Accountant, providing guidance and feedback to support development and maintain quality
* Collaborate across accounting functions to ensure close timelines and deliverables are met
* Support daily treasury operations, including cash monitoring, transaction recording, and short-term forecasting
* Assist with weekly cash disbursements, including review of ACH and wire activity
* Prepare audit schedules, respond to auditor requests, and maintain supporting documentation
* Contribute to ERP system enhancements, partnering with Finance and IT to improve workflows, reporting, and data integrity
* Identify and implement process improvements to drive efficiency across accounting and treasury functions
* Support ad hoc projects and evolving business initiatives
